Job description

Job Description

The Creative Agency Team (CAT) is Gameloft’s internal creative agency, responsible for producing marketing and user acquisition assets for games across multiple studios and regions. Reporting directly to the CAT Lead, the Creative Project Manager is responsible for ensuring the efficient flow of creative production activities across projects. This role acts as a central point of coordination between the CAT team and its stakeholders, helping to ensure that work is clearly briefed, properly planned, well tracked, and delivered on time.

The Creative Project Manager plays a key role in enabling smooth production by reviewing incoming briefs and requests, confirming production readiness before kick-off, managing timelines and priorities, and supporting the team throughout all stages of the creative process. This person partners closely with the CAT Lead to maintain strong organization, facilitate communication, anticipate production needs, and improve team efficiency through better workflows, planning, and documentation.

Key Responsibilities
  • Manage creative projects end-to-end, coordinating timelines, milestones, deliverables, feedback rounds and approvals to ensure work is delivered on time and to expectations.
  • Coordinate stakeholders and production teams, acting as a central point of contact between the Creative Agency Team, artists, marketing, UA, game teams, legal, licensors and external partners.
  • Drive production planning and prioritisation, partnering with the CAT Lead to define priorities, allocate work, manage dependencies and proactively identify and resolve blockers and risks.
  • Oversee project tracking and workflows, maintaining accurate project plans, schedules, task assignments and progress tracking in Airtable, while continuously improving production visibility and efficiency.
  • Support creative quality and delivery, ensuring briefs and assets are production-ready, feedback is clearly communicated, and final deliverables meet project requirements, creative expectations and brand guidelines.
  • Improve processes and ways of working, developing documentation, templates and best practices, analysing production data, and collaborating with other Creative Project Managers to drive consistency and efficiency across teams.
What success will look like
  • Production readiness: Creative requests are clearly defined and production-ready before kickoff, with briefs, assets, owners, timelines, and approvals in place.
  • Reliable delivery: Projects are well planned, tracked, and delivered against agreed milestones, with dependencies, feedback, approvals, and risks anticipated early.
  • Visibility & risk management: The CAT Lead, artists, and stakeholders have clear visibility of priorities, progress, blockers, and delivery risks, with issues addressed proactively.
  • Strong collaboration: Communication with artists and key stakeholders is clear, structured, and proactive, keeping expectations aligned throughout production.
  • Operational efficiency: Workflows, tools, documentation, and reporting are organised and continuously improved to increase visibility, consistency, and efficiency.

Overall: The Creative Project Manager provides the structure and support needed for the team to focus on creative quality while ensuring projects are delivered reliably and stakeholders remain confident.

Life at Gameloft

Gameloft Brisbane, part of the global Gameloft family, opened its doors in 2014 and has since delivered hit titles such as Zombie Anarchy, Ballistic Baseball, My Little Pony: Mane Merge, the multi-award-winning The Oregon TrailTM, and Carmen Sandiego.

Today, we are the largest video game studio in Queensland, employing more than 130 talented professionals across programming, art, design, production, QA, audio, marketing, administration and management. Together, we create immersive gaming experiences enjoyed by millions of players around the world.

We are proud to be developing Bluey’s Happy Snaps, bringing one of Australia’s most iconic IPs to life in a brand-new interactive experience. As we continue to grow, we’re also working on a range of exciting unannounced projects that will help shape the future of our studio.
